ICO start a new year with future objectives
To
start a new year, once the summer holidays have finished, makes
one think about the things that we have done but, above
all, about the things which we want to do in the near future.
It is now the moment to set new objectives which guarantee the
relevance of our Institution in the framework of an eventual
Institut Nacional de Càncer de Catalunya . In this new
framework, which is now starting to be defined within the background
of Health Care in our country, ICO has to face its responsibilities
as the Integral Centre for Cancer that it is nowadays.
This responsibility has to be proven not by looking back to past
excellence, but exercising the capacities to face more ambitious
challenges. The past, brilliant though it may be, is only history
which we can be proud of and learn from. What really counts,
however, is the future. This must fulfil three basic axes: the
capacity to give quality service to the patients; the capacity
to achieve the satisfaction of the professionals and the capacity
to be a referent for society.
These capacities have to be compatible with a possible financial
reality, so we have to be both efficient and effective. We have
to be sensible and accurate when using the public money which
citizens put at our disposal. Our management must be austere
and we can not waste a single euro. The best management, the
one with best quality, is doing things properly the first time.
For this, it is necessary to make clinic decisions, both diagnostic
and therapy, based on expertise. Excellence is the aim; it is
our goal. Excellence in the assistance and the treatment of the
patients is the best we can give in return to their trust. But,
in order to reach excellence we have to invest all kinds of efforts
in the fields of research and innovation. ICO’s reality
in epidemiologic and translational basic and clinic research,
as corresponds to an integral centre for cancer, is the reference
model for the future. In the same way, we can speak of a multidisciplinary
assistance model which still has to improve significantly so
that it can be more of a reality.
Prevention, assistance and research are, then, the pillars of
our Institution. They are the way in which we can fulfil our
mission: “To work in order to minimize the impact of cancer
in Catalonia”. After all, it is the effect of the efficient
application of our knowledge. This is one of the greatest challenges
of the future. In a global, developing world, the use of tools
for information and communication, the capacities of all organizations
and, above all, of those whose fundament lies on their knowledge,
will have their future determined by their capacity to manage
it efficiently.
